A apresentação está carregando. Por favor, espere

A apresentação está carregando. Por favor, espere

PARALELISMO EM NÍVEL DE THREAD

Apresentações semelhantes


Apresentação em tema: "PARALELISMO EM NÍVEL DE THREAD"— Transcrição da apresentação:

1 PARALELISMO EM NÍVEL DE THREAD
Instituto de Computação Universidade Estadual de Campinas PARALELISMO EM NÍVEL DE THREAD Disciplina MO401 :: 1s2010 R.A.: Camila Satsu de Amorim Yokoigawa

2 SMT - Simultaneous MultiThreading
Explora TLP e ILP; Ganho de desempenho relacionado ao melhoramento de Throughput; Garantir a integridade e o desempenho apesar dos conflitos de cachê e TLB representa um desafio. 1 - 8

3 CMP – Chip MultiProcessor
Power4 Grupo de núcleos integrados dentro de um único chip de processamento. Possui metade do tamanho de cachê L2 de SMT. Comportamento térmico e custo de refrigeração são preocupações importantes. Conjunto de Benchmark com miss rate baixo na L2 Conjunto de Benchmark com miss rate alto na L2 2 - 8

4 Hyper-Threading Tecnologia Intel baseada no paradigma SMT.
Consiste em um processador físico trabalha em nível lógico como se fosse vários. Implementado pelos processadores da família Xeon da Intel. 3 - 8

5 Ben Hyper-Threading Máquina Power 4 Benchmark de OLTP
Observado ganho de desempenho em uma média de 25% para Hyper-Threading ativado. Benchmark de Servidor 4 - 8

6 Niagara Adota o paradigma CMT.
Possui 8 núcleos, capazes de executar 4 threads cada. Cada núcleo tem frequência de 1.4GHz. Consome em média 72W. Possui uma unidade de ponto flutuante. 5 - 8

7 Niagara Benchmark Specjjb2005 Benchmark Specwe2005 Benchmark Sap-2Tier
6 - 8

8 OpenMP Conjunto de bibliotecas C, C++ e Fortran que provê uma interface flexível para o desenvolvimento de aplicações paralelas em multiprocessadores shared memory. Gráfico de análise de duas simples aplicações de cálculo de π . Com uma delas com implementação de OpenMP. 7 - 8

9 8 - 8


Carregar ppt "PARALELISMO EM NÍVEL DE THREAD"

Apresentações semelhantes


Anúncios Google